原文:MySQL--MODIFY COLUMN和ALTER COLUMN

MySQL可以使用MODIFY COLUMN ALTER COLUMN CHANGE三种方式修改列属性。 对于部分只需要修改表定义而不需要修改表数据的操作,使用ALTER COLUMN操作可以避免数据发生移动,提高ALTER 操作效率。 仅需要修改表结构的操作有: 更改字段的默认值 增加和删除字段的AUTO INCREMENT属性 主要是增加属性而不是增加字段 增删改ENUM的常量值 但MySQL ...

2019-02-17 11:57 0 7387 推荐指数:

查看详情

MySQLALTER COLUMNMODIFY COLUMN 和 CHANGE COLUMN

ALTER COLUMNMODIFY COLUMN 和 CHANGE COLUMN 语句修改列: ALTER COLUMN:改变、删除列的默认值(备注:列的默认值存储在 .frm 文件中)。 这个语句会直接修改 .frm 文件而不涉及表数据,所以操作很快。 -- 改变列 ...

Fri Feb 28 07:42:00 CST 2020 0 2555
alter table add column default

alter table tableA add columnN NUMBER(4) DEFAULT 0; 此语句会执行很久(当然根据表大小) 可以使用下面两条替代: alter table tableA add columnN number(4); alter table tableA ...

Mon Apr 20 02:01:00 CST 2020 0 4006
MySQLALTER ,CHANGE , MODIFY

ALTER TABLE project_list CHANGE COLUMN descriptionofproj proj_desc VARCHAR(100), CHANGE COLUMN contractoronjob con_name VARCHAR(30); MODIFY:使用它可以只修改 ...

Thu Jul 12 18:46:00 CST 2018 0 1557
@Column

@Column注解一共有10个属性,这10个属性均为可选属性,各属性含义分别如下: name name属性定义了被标注字段在数据库表中所对应字段的名称; unique unique属性表示该字段是否为唯一标识,默认为false。如果表中有一个字段需要唯一标识,则既可以使用该标记,也可以使 ...

Wed Oct 16 23:36:00 CST 2019 0 840
Mysql 列修改语句alter/changer/modify

column在语句中可以省略alter column:设置或删除列的默认值。该操作会直接修改.frm文件而不涉及表数据。所以,这个操作非常快mySQL> desc example6 ...

Tue Jun 06 00:51:00 CST 2017 0 5181
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M